He hobbled in, erect and martial of bearing despite the crutch, and his dark citizen's suit emphasized the whiteness of his face.

Being home had softened Blair a little.

Yet the pride and tragic bitterness were there.

But when Blair espied Lane a warmth burned out of the havoc in his face.

Lane's conscience gave him a twinge.
